Boost for ‘Save Ely Cinema’ campaign from ‘Yesterday’ film star Himesh Patel

The British Asian actor best known as Tamwar Massod on Eastenders is playing the lead in a new big-budget film Yesterday by Danny Boyle, out this Summer.  Born in Cambridgeshire, Himesh heard about the campaign to Save Ely Cinema through his local connections and is keen to lend his support.

‘I've visited Ely several times and know what an asset the independent cinema is for the City. I’m really pleased to be supporting the Save Ely Cinema campaign and I hope Babylon Arts is able to raise the money it needs to keep it going’  Watch the clip of Himesh talking about the campaign here

The initial target was to raise £3000 by 1st June to cover the annual warranty and maintenance costs of the cinema kit. Caroline Cawley from Babylon ARTS who manage the cinema said ‘We’ve been overwhelmed by people's support and have smashed our first target. We now need to continue our appeal to raise the remaining £7000 to meet our over-all target of £17,000. We’d like to say a big thank you to all our original pledgers and ask everyone to continue to coming to see more films, more often at our riverside cinema to ensure its long term survival.’
